Spotlight on K-12 School/District Campus Safety Director of the Year Finalist Ian Lopez

Check out some of this Director of the Year finalist’s top accomplishments, as well as a photo gallery of him and his department.

Congratulations to Ian Lopez, Director of Safety and Security at Cherry Creek School District, for being named one of this year’s K-12 school/district Campus Safety Director of the Year finalists.

Some of his notable achievements include:

  • Created a 24-hour dispatch operations center, combining transportation, maintenance, and security, resulting in cost savings and efficiencies.
  • Installed an integrated radio, intercom, digital signage, and emergency notification system in alignment with the Standard Response Protocol.
  • Sought out and received bond money to retrofit Cherry Creek schools with protective window film on all lower levels.
